Notice of Privacy Practices
This notice describes how medical information about you may be used and disclosed
and how you can get access to this information. Please review it carefully.
Permitted Uses and Disclosures
drivePT my disclose your medical record for:
1. Coordination of treatment with other health care providers, or in emergency situations
with serious threats to health or safety.
2. Payment of services rendered (3rd party, Auto, or Worker’s compensation)
3. Healthcare operations: We may use your healthcare records to check the quality of
healthcare you receive and in audits, fraud, and abuse
programs/planning/management.
4. For legal purposes as compelled according to local, state, and federal regulations.
5. Family or friends involved in your direct care permitted by you.
6. For Public Health Authorities to control or prevent disease, injury, disability, deaths,
abuse, or neglect.
7. We may use and disclose your PHI for research purposes, but we will only disclose
PHI if approved by an authorized institutional review board or a privacy board that has
reviewed the research proposal and has set up protocols to ensure the privacy of your
PHI.
Patient Rights
1. Request restrictions on the use of your medical information for any of the services
listed above, however drivePT is not required by law to accept your request.
2. Request confidential communication of your protected health information.
3. Request copies of your medical information to be delivered to other locations. You
may be responsible for any expenses incurred for these alternative services (i.e.
copying and mailing records)
4. Request to view your medical records.
5. Request an addition or amendment be made to your medical information, subject to
certain restrictions.
6. Request a paper copy of the Notice of Privacy Practices.
